State Bank of India has made an undisclosed investment in digital payments firm Cashfree. The Bengaluru-based company. which had raised $35 million in November 2020, will focus on customer experience and product innovation.
Founded by Reeju Datta and Akash Sinha, Cashfree provides full-stack payments solutions to over 100,000 growing businesses through a single integration. The company claims to process transactions worth $20 billion annually and profitability for three consecutive fiscal years.
